    Scientific Essay from the year 2016 in the subject Leadership and Human Resources - Miscellaneous, grade: 64, Cardiff Metropolitan University, course: MBA, language: English, abstract: Using a qualitative research approach anchored on secondary data, the objective of this paper is to assess the various roles of HR professionals that are unique to every organisation according to the demands of the organisations that are usually based upon the business objectives of the firm. HR professionals are placed with the task of facilitating the changes that are necessary for achieving organisational change that are vital to the success of the firm. This paper will scrutinize various literature related to HR Roles and provide indisputable facts that reveal the true nature of the functional sphere of the HR professional who often have a misconstrued perception of their true role. This casual research paper will primarily examine multitude secondary data that provide insight into the role of the HR professional coupled with empirical evidence based on observations and surveys conducted by previous researchers over the last three decades on how organisations have relied on HRD as a champion of change that requires them to draw attention to the needs of the organisation and formulate practical and applicable methods towards meeting these changes with the least amount of resistance. The subsequent review of literature that will be presented will start with a review of Collins and the emphasis placed on HR management concepts and approaches that are developed based on organisational structures which are in turn bounded to cultural elements and how these are streamlined with business objectives which further contribute to the complexity of the entire organisational framework. The review of literature will also contain examples of organisations that owe success not only to their products, but also the innovative HR approach that enabled these companies to attract and retain the best of talents within their industry that gave them the competitive advantage over their rivals
